Asian Pacific Islander Demographics Data


San Diego County Figures
(Based on 2000 Census Data)

  All Ages 18 years and over
Subject Number Percent Number Percent

     Total Population

2,813,833 100.0 2,090,172 100.0
One race 2,681,866 95.3 2,017,821 96.5
Two or more races 131,967 4.7 72,351 3.5
     Asian 249,802 8.9 191,544 9.2
     Native Hawaiian and
     other Pacific Islander
13,561 0.5 9,626 0.5

CSUSM API Student Figures
(Based on Spring 2001 Enrollment)

  Spring 2001
Count
Spring 2001
Percentages
Spring 2001
Potential Graduates
Total students 581 9.41% 135
     Asian Indian 24 0.39%  
     Cambodian 6 0.10%  
     Chinese 63 1.02%  
     Filipino 257 4.16%  
     Guamanian 7 0.11%  
     Hawaiian 13 0.21%  
     Japanese 41 0.66%  
     Korean 24 0.39%  
     Laotian 9 0.15%  
     Other Asian 41 0.66%  
     Other Pacific Islander 6 0.10%  
     Other Southeast Asian 0 0.00%  
     Samoan 5 0.08%  
     Thai 11 0.18%  
     Vietnamese 74 1.20%  

NOTE: This data represents a growing number of Asian Pacific Islander students at CSU San Marcos.
